However, the workaround has the problem with 79C970A 10M full duplex cards which causes the netowrk slowing-down. To solve this problem, the workaound is set to be turned on for "79C975" only. Please apply. -- GO! --- linux/drivers/net/pcnet32.c.orig Mon May 27 17:15:12 2002 +++ linux/drivers/net/pcnet32.c Tue May 28 12:35:29 2002 @@ -847,8 +847,9 @@ if (lp->options == (PCNET32_PORT_FD | PCNET32_PORT_AUI)) val |= 2; } else if (lp->options & PCNET32_PORT_ASEL) { - /* workaround for xSeries250 */ - val |= 3; + /* workaround of xSeries250, turn on for 79C975 only */ + i = ((lp->a.read_csr(ioaddr, 88) | (lp->a.read_csr(ioaddr,89) << 16)) >> 12) & 0xffff; + if (i == 0x2627) val |= 3; } lp->a.write_bcr (ioaddr, 9, val); }
